The 1980 SC was the first 911 with electronic lambda control. The box is under the passengers seat. The fuse #4 supplies also this box. When it's broken no power supply is there and lambda control is fully out of service. Esp. the cycle valve doesn't operate any more, which manages the fuel distributor pressure. Do you have an oxygen sensor ("Lambdasonde") still installed?
Refer to Andrews (user AndrewCologne here) fabulous website according those engines: https://nineelevenheaven.wordpress.com/der-911-us-sc-3-0-motor-mit-g-kat/ Schematics you find here: https://classickabelboomcompany.com/wiring-diagram-porsche/ Unfortunately not for the 1980 model, but you can use them of the '81-'83 models. There only slight differences, I suppose your car doesn't have the acceleration box (an additional electronic box which enrichens the mixture for 2secs on accelerating, but no necessary for older cars) Thomas

Welcome Bodo. :-)
Then your lambda control unit incl. the frequency valve (located at the front side of the engine, hidden in the back when standing behind the car) is somewhat aputated. This means the control box operates the frequency valve in the "limb home mode" meaning that it is operated at 50% duty cycle without the signal of an oxygen sensor. This is a emergency mode to get home when oxygen sensor is bad. So this will cause lower performance and higher fuel consumption. Unfortunately often seen on these cars coming back to Germany.... A Workshop Manual is available as a pdf for CIS 911. It contains diagrams for 78 and later years (81 and more).
For the SC 80, the only diagram I found in this book is a supplement called "Additional Current Flow Diagram, Type 911 SC USA, Model 80". This supplement deals with the Oxygen Sensor System. I can make this pdf available as a wetransfer link if you want it. Let me know.
